Typical Day-to-Day Activities
- Strip outs: Isolating hot and cold feeds, removing existing baths, tiles, and flooring
- First fix plumbing: Routing existing pipework out of the wet area and installing new cold feeds to showers
- Making good walls for tiling: Dry lining or bonding walls
- Studwork: Building stud walls where required to house pipework and electrics
- Fitting Tuff Form trays: Cutting out floorboards to facilitate installation of Tuff Form trays, gravity waste runs, and connections
- Preparing subfloors: Laying 6mm plywood overlay to remaining floor areas
- Wall tiling: Approximately 10m of tiling within wet areas plus splashback tiling to basins (average tile size 250mm x 250mm)
- Removing and refitting existing WCs to facilitate installation of new safety flooring
- Second fix plumbing: Installing new basins, semi-pedestals, and showers
- Installing standard 750mm wet room screens
- Fitting grab rails: Communicating with clients to determine the best positioning
- Cleaning and sealing completed works
Additional Information
- Flooring will be carried out by others
- Electrical works will be carried out by others
